A delicate graphite study of the Dutch coastline near Renesse, featuring sailing vessels and a lighthouse by Willem Anthonie van Deventer.
This graphite drawing by the Dutch marine artist Willem Anthonie van Deventer captures a quiet moment along the coast of Renesse. Van Deventer, known for his focus on maritime subjects and the Dutch coastline, employs a restrained technique here. The composition is defined by a vast, open expanse of sky and sand, which draws the eye toward the horizon line where the sea meets the atmosphere.
To the left, two vessels are depicted with precise, delicate lines: a larger sailing ship and a smaller boat. These forms provide a sense of scale against the emptiness of the shore. On the right, a lighthouse stands atop a dune, serving as a subtle marker of the coastal geography. The foreground is rendered with minimal detail, suggesting the texture of the beach through light, sparse marks.
Van Deventer often travelled along the Dutch coast to document the interaction between the sea and the land. This work reflects his observational approach, prioritising clarity and spatial depth over elaborate shading. The inscription in the lower left corner, noting the date and location, suggests this was likely a field study or a direct observation made during his travels. The work is held in the collection of the Rijksmuseum, reflecting its value as a record of nineteenth-century Dutch maritime life.
